14 hex
0 hex Overcurrent
The current flowing through the converter
exceeded the specified value.
•
The Servo Drive is faulty (faulty circuit,
faulty IGBT part, etc.).
•
Disconnect the motor cable, and turn
ON the servo. If the problem
immediately recurs, replace the Servo
Drive with a new one.
•
The motor cable is short-circuited
between phases U, V, and W.
•
Check to see if the motor cable is
short-circuited between phases U, V and
W by checking for loose wire strands on
the connector lead. Connect the motor
cable correctly.
•
The motor cable is ground-faulted.
•
Check the insulation resistance between
phases U, V, and W of the motor cable
and the grounding wire of the motor. If
the insulation is faulty, replace the motor.
•
Motor windings are burned out.
•
Check the balance between the
resistance of each wire of the motor. If
resistance is unbalanced, replace the
motor.
1 hex IPM Error
•
The motor wiring contacts are faulty.
•
Check for missing connector pins in
motor connections U, V, and W. If any
loose or missing connector pins are
found, secure them firmly.
•
The relay for the dynamic brake has
been welded due to frequent servo
ON/OFF operations.
•
Replace the Servo Drive. Do not start or
stop the system by turning the servo ON
or OFF.
•
The motor is not suitable for the Servo
Drive.
•
Check model (capacity) of the motor and
the Servo Drive on the nameplates.
Replace the motor with a motor that
matches the Servo Drive.
•
The command input timing is the same
as or earlier than the Servo ON timing.
•
Wait at least 100 ms after the servo has
been turned ON, then input commands.
•
The resistance of the connected
External Regeneration Resistor is less
than the minimum allowable value.
*1
•
Connect an External Regeneration
Resistor whose resistance is more than
the minimum allowable value.
*2
15 hex
0 hex Servo Drive
Overheat
The temperature of the Servo Drive
radiator or power elements exceeded the
specified value.
•
The ambient temperature of the Servo
Drive exceeded the specified value.
•
Improve the ambient temperature and
the cooling conditions of the Servo
Drive.
•
Overload
•
Increase the capacities of the Servo
Drive and the motor. Set longer
acceleration and deceleration times.
Reduce the load.
